%0 Case Reports %T Fatal case of enterovirus 71 infection, France, 2007. %A Vallet S %A Legrand Quillien MC %A Dailland T %A Podeur G %A Gouriou S %A Schuffenecker I %A Payan C %A Marcorelles P %J Emerg Infect Dis %V 15 %N 11 %D Nov 2009 %M 19891879 %F 16.126 %R 10.3201/eid1511.090493 %X A fatal case of enterovirus 71 infection with pulmonary edema and rhombencephalitis occurred in Brest, France, in April 2007. The virus was identified as subgenogroup C2. This highly neurotropic enterovirus merits specific surveillance outside the Asia-Pacific region.
